A cryptic image posted by Geoff Keighley, host of The Game Awards, has sent the gaming community into a speculative frenzy. The enigmatic visual, featuring a peculiar, armored structure with mixed demonic and animalistic imagery, has fueled fan theories about major game announcements. Many are hoping for reveals of highly anticipated titles such as Half-Life 3 or The Elder Scrolls 6.
Initial interpretations by fans have suggested connections to popular franchises, including God of War, with some noting similarities to Norse mythology. However, a significant body of evidence, including visual elements that strongly match the aesthetic of Diablo 4, suggests a more specific reveal. This has led many to believe the image is a teaser for a Diablo 4 downloadable content expansion.
While the exact nature of the reveal remains unconfirmed by Keighley, the consensus among many online discussions leans heavily towards a Diablo 4 expansion. This potential announcement comes as fans eagerly await news on The Elder Scrolls 6, seven years after its initial teaser. The Game Awards 2025 promises to be a focal point for these awaited gaming revelations.
